@silas
free shipping, i am guessing, would be the Rs 750 handling charges Dell charges when you place the order. So its possible for them to waive this off. -

Actually when you try to configure your laptop online and finalize it you will get to another page.... There an option is available to get a tax-free and octroi-free delivery but that will add 4-5 days extra (according to that page).... So free shipping can be availed by anyone I guess.... And after requesting for a quote and you give the contact number a DELL CSR would call you for confirmation of details and other stuff... That time I think you can talk to him to get more discounts and stuff..... It depends though....
And Vishal the reason I said you can get your laptop soon because most of the people are now ordering only Inspiron 1x20 series and Vostro 1x00 series.... The parts for these two series of models are almost the same..... So DELL would not have stock for them immediately....
But if you order a 6400 (which not so many ppl are now ordering) chances are that no parts have to be back-ordered (i.e. all of the required parts will be available in stock) and so the build-time will be even less....
But I guess most of the late deliveries now are mainly due to customs delays (still dont know if it is the truth)...... So on the whole you should get your laptop somewhere before 3 weeks if my prediction is correct... -

@silas:
regarding the how do i know query? - when you first configure the system online, the price which appears is not the price given in the ad but includes the delivery, etc. (Dell calls it handling charges, insurance charges, etc.). Plus when you pay, they do not inform you that any additional payment is to be made. Courier companies do not collect cash from customer unless its VPP, etc.
However, if you really want to be sure, spk to Dell CSR and confirm about the addnl payment.
As regards discounts, what Dell waive is Octroi and VAT (in which case there is 4-5 days delay in delivery due to the circuitous route adopted).
